idea中java怎么链接数据库里的表
时间: 2024-10-25 13:13:35 浏览: 20
在IntelliJ IDEA中连接数据库并操作表,通常需要通过数据源配置和使用数据库驱动。以下是步骤:
1. **设置数据库驱动**:
- 首先,确保已经安装了对应数据库的JDBC驱动。例如,如果你使用的是MySQL,需要下载mysql-connector-java.jar。
2. **添加数据源**:
- 打开IntelliJ IDEA,点击菜单栏 "File" -> "Settings" (Windows/Linux) 或 "IntelliJ IDEA" -> "Preferences" (Mac),然后选择 "Data Sources"(数据源)。
- 点击"+"图标,选择 "Database" 并填写相关信息,如数据库URL、用户名和密码。
3. **创建或导入项目数据库模块**:
- 创建新的模块(如果你还没做),选择 "JDBC" 数据库模块作为模块类型。
- 如果已有数据库模块,可以从 "Structure" -> "Database" 中添加数据源。
4. **编写连接代码**:
- 使用`java.sql.Connection` 类来建立到数据库的连接,比如使用 `DriverManager.getConnection()` 函数。
```java
String url = "jdbc:mysql://localhost:3306/mydatabase";
String user = "username";
String password = "password";
Connection connection = DriverManager.getConnection(url, user, password);
```
5. **执行SQL查询**:
- 创建`Statement`或`PreparedStatement`对象来执行SQL语句(包括SELECT, INSERT等操作)。
6. **处理结果集**:
- 使用`ResultSet`获取查询结果,并根据需要读取数据。
```java
Statement statement = connection.createStatement();
String sql = "SELECT * FROM my_table";
ResultSet resultSet = statement.executeQuery(sql);
while (resultSet.next()) {
// 处理每一行数据
}
```
阅读全文